Carbon Monoxide Leak at Ocean City Resort Hospitalizes Four, Investigation Underway

Odorless carbon monoxide exposed 17 individuals to danger when alarms sounded at the beachfront hotel

Overview

  • Fire crews responded to a carbon monoxide alarm at Ashore Resort and Beach Club around 11 a.m. on August 1, evaluating 17 people and transporting four with elevated levels to nearby hospitals.
  • No fatalities have been reported, and officials have not released updates on the conditions of the hospitalized guests.
  • Personnel from the Fire Marshal’s Office, building inspection units and the local gas utility remain on site probing the leak’s origin.
  • The incident underscores the acute health risks posed by undetectable carbon monoxide, which accounts for over 400 unintentional poisoning deaths in the U.S. each year.
  • The leak disrupted operations at the 250-room beachfront resort opened in May 2023, raising questions about safety protocols in hospitality venues.
